A unimolecular theranostic system with H(2)O(2)-specific response and AIE-activity for doxorubicin releasing and real-time tracking in living cells
A theranostic drug delivery system composed of tetraphenyl-ethene (AIEgen), benzyl boronic ester (trigger), and doxorubicin (drug) was designed and synthesized; its utilities for cell imaging, drug delivery tracking, and cancer cell cytociding were evaluated.
